15-year-old bride arrested on accuse say she poison her husband on dia wedding night

Police don detain one 15-year-old girl for Albasu village for Jahun Local Goment Area of Jigawa State, northern Nigeria on di accuse say she try to kill her husband and im friends by putting poison for dia food.
Di poison allegedly kill one of di groom friends, wey bin dey plan naming ceremony for im new twins.
For interview wit BBC Pidgin, di groom wey be 34 years old, wey escape death, beg di authorities to find justice for dem.
E tok say im and di bride bin don dey date for two years bifor dem marry for Friday, December 20, 2024 for dia village Bakata for Kiyawa Local Goment Area, Jigawa State.
Normally, di groom suppose spend di first night wit di bride, but e bin say e no wan go dat night.
"Sunday night, afta dem carry di bride come. My late friend and di oda one tok say make I go spend night wit my bride, but I tell dem say I no wan go dat night," e tok.
Di groom explain say e bin dey tailor shop wit him friends wen di bride friends bring di food come.
"Around 10:00PM we dey tailor shop wey belong to my friend. Na so her friends waka bring food —jollof noodles wit meat. As we start to dey chop am, we notice say sometin dey strange for di food, so we stop dey chop.
My late friend begin dey complain say im belle dey pain am. Me too, I begin dey feel pain for my belly. We find milk drink but e no work. Later, dem rush us go Kiyawa hospital, but my friend no make am."

Di groom say e shock say dis kain tin happun becos dem love each oda bifor dem marry.
"Na love marriage we do, but na destiny and immaturity as small girl cause dis," e tok.
"We dey sad say we lose person, but she still be my wife sake of say I don pay her dowry," di groom add.
Di oda friend wey survive, describe dia late friend as a good man and close friend.
E tok say di incident happun di day before im twins naming ceremony.
"E meet us for tailor shop as usual after e return from market wia e buy baby tins for di twins naming ceremony wey dem plan for di next day.
Na so di bride friends waka come bring food say na di bride send dem. As we start to chop, we notice sometin strange inside di food and we stop. Dem rush us go hospital, but our friend no survive," e tok.
E add say, "dem don cheat me by killing my best friend, good person. Now, I dey alone, and I no dey enjoy my tailoring work again. We need justice."

Di late man papa, tok say im son na religious man wey dey take care of im parents.
"Na di only son I get, and na im dey provide food for us. Now dem don kill am, leave me wit im small pikin and di newborn twins.
Abeg, make una help us find justice because I no know wetin I go do now." im papa tok.
Di villagers confirm say di bride don dey for police headquarters for Dutse, Jigawa State, for investigation.
Jigawa police spokesperson, Lawan Shiisu, confirm di incident to journalists say:
One 15yrs girl of Bagata Gabas village "conspire with her ex-lover, wey be 22yrs of Bagata Gabas Yamma village, for Kiyawa LGA, to poison her husband food, wey be 29yrs of Albasu village, Jahun LGA.
Di husband and im two friends eat di food together, and as a result, dem develop stomach-aches.
Dem rush di victims go hospital, where one of di groom friends dey confirmed dead by di medical doctor on call. Di case dey under investigation."

Nigeria law on child marriage
Nigeria law dey complicated wen e come to di issue of child marriage.
Di kontri get four different legal systems – English law, Common Law, Customary Law and Sharia Law.
Di Sharia Law or Islamic Law like im name suggest na from di Islam religion.
All of dis legal systems get dia power from di Nigeria Constitution wey be di Supreme binding force for every authority for di kontri.
Muslims dey follow di practice of Prophet Mohammed wey marry Aishah wen she be dey six years, consummate di marriage wen she turn nine years.
For di Nigeria Constitution though, di mata no straight. Di Federal Child Rights Act (2003), say na taboo to marry below di age of 18 years.
While Nigeria goment na signatory of dis UN Act and dem ratify am for dia federal law, according to Nigeria law, for any international act to dey binding on im pipo, di National Assembly go ratify am, den di 36 State Assembly go domesticate am for dia state.
And no be all states don domesticate am.
Not all states for northern Nigeria don stamp di Child's Rights Act (CRA) of 2003:
Di CRA don face challenges of enactment for northern states, sake of cultural and religious practices.
So as di CRA ban child marriage, other laws make exceptions. Child marriage common for some northern states, where Islam na di dominant religion.
